You’ll deliver well-scoped services across Elixir / Phoenix — distributed systems, real-time freight events, data orchestration, and reliability work that keeps mission-critical workflows alive — and help shape the patterns, abstractions, and quality bar the wider engineering team relies on.
The role is set up for growth: you'll be given progressively more ambiguous problems, expected to take initiative beyond the assigned ticket, and supported to grow into end-to-end ownership over the next 6–12 months.
This isn't brochureware or content management. You'll be working on enterprise-grade, data-intensive applications where performance and state management matter to global logistics networks.
Agentic AI is a real part of how we work — across our SDLC and inside the product. We use coding agents, agentic prompting, and MCP-based tooling in day-to-day delivery, and we're building native agentic AI into the platform itself, not a bolted-on chatbot. You'll grow your craft inside that environment, not separate from it.
